Description
To adjust the brightness of the screen.
To adjust the contrast of the screen.
Set your own gamma value.
: 1.8 ~ 2.6
On the monitor, high gamma values
display whitish images and low gamma
values display blackish images.
You can set the offset level. If the black
level value becomes higher, the screen
grows brighter. If the value becomes
lower, the screen grows darker.
(Only for HDMI input)
* Offset? As the criteria for video signal, it
is the darkest screen the monitor
can show.
If the output of the video card is different
the required specifications, the color level
may deteriorate due to video signal
distortion. Using this function, the signal
level is adjusted to fit into the standard
output level of the video card in order to
provide the optimal image.
Activate this function when white and
black colors are present in the screen.
(Only for DVI-I analog input)
